Fix list for XL Fortran for Linux

Product documentation


Abstract

This document contains a complete listing of releases, refreshes, fix packs and interim fixes sorted by version for IBM XL Fortran for Linux.

Content

Tab navigation

IBM Rational Software Support Communities
  • Visit the IBM Support Portal to configure your support portal experience and review FAQs, lists of known problems, fixes, and a wealth of important support information.
  • Interact with other compiler users on the Fortran Cafe blog, forum and wiki.

Follow IBM Compilers on Twitter | Facebook | Google+


IBM Rational Software Support Communities

  • Visit developerWorks to access an online collection of tutorials, sample code, standards, forums and other resources provided by experts at IBM to assist software developers using Rational tools including access to the IBM RFE Community.
  • Visit the Jazz Community if you use a Rational product created using the Jazz platform to interact directly with the Jazz development team and other community members, download product trials and betas and track development progress.

Follow IBM Rational Client Support on Twitter | Facebook | YouTube | devWorks Blog


Helpful Hints For Obtaining Technical Assistance:

Before you contact IBM Rational Compiler Support, gather the background information that you need to describe the problem. When you describe a problem to an IBM software support specialist, be as specific as possible and include all relevant background information so that the specialist can help you solve the problem efficiently. To save time, know the answers to these questions:

  • Can the issue be reduced to a small test case?
  • Can the test case be provided to IBM?
  • What compiler version and fix pack level were you using when the problem occurred?
    • This can be found by compiling with the -qversion=verbose compiler option.
  • Do you have logs, traces, or messages that are related to the problem?
  • Can you reproduce the problem? If so, what steps and compiler options do you use to reproduce it?
  • Is there a workaround for the problem? If so, be prepared to describe the workaround.

To open a PMR, use the IBM Service Request tool.

If you have helpful information to diagnose or identify the problem on your system, you can provide this data by following the instructions to exchange information with IBM Technical Support.

Table of Contents:


Initial Release (15.1.1)
Link Date Released Status
APAR Description
-- Initial release

Table of Contents:


Fix Pack 1 (15.1.0.1)
Link Date Released Status
APAR Description
LI78274 Compiler incorrectly detects the extent of a derived type element
LI78275 Procedure pointer gets invalid offset
LI78257 XLF OMP threadprivate allocation failure
LI78261 Scalar as the actual argument corresponding to an assumed-size dummy argument of assumed-type
LI78251 XL Fortran for Linux Fix Pack 1 (October 2014 Update) for 15.1
LI78252 XL Fortran Runtime for Linux Fix Pack 1 (October 2014 Update) for 15.1

Initial Release (15.1)
Link Date Released Status
APAR Description
-- Initial release

Table of Contents:


Fix Pack 7 (14.1.0.7)
Link Date Released Status
APAR Description
LI77930 Incorrect error message for reduction statement
LI77965 Internal compiler error when module is empty
LI77932 Internal compiler error with missing procedure list
LI77961 May 2014 Update for XL Fortran for Linux, V14.1
LI77962 May 2014 Runtime for XL Fortran for Linux, V14.1

Fix Pack 6 (14.1.0.6)
Link Date Released Status
APAR Description
LI77823 Incorrect DWARF info for threadprivate common block
LI77799 Pointer self assignment causes corrupt bounds
LI77825 Internal error in xlfhot with polymorphic
LI77701 Enable -qnosave as the default for _r invocation
LI77882 February 2014 Update for XL Fortran for Linux, V14.1
LI77883 February 2014 Runtime for XL Fortran for Linux, V14.1

Fix Pack 5 (14.1.0.5)
Link Date Released Status
APAR Description
LI77748 December 2013 Update for XL Fortran for Linux, V14.1
LI77749 December 2013 Runtime for XL Fortran for Linux, V14.1

Fix Pack 4 (14.1.0.4)
Link Date Released Status
APAR Description
LI77677 Incorrect array bound checks at -O5
LI77604 Internal compiler error in XLCCODE with -qstrict =vectorprecision
LI77678 Dwarf error mangled line number gprof message
LI77649 Signal 11 in xlfhot with CSHIFT
LI77650 Signal 11 from xlfhot
LI77651 Assertion `scope_diff > 0' failed
LI77682 Incorrect output from Fortran/C binding procedure with -O
LI77660 Incorrect SAVE attribute error message
LI77663 Internal error with USE in external function
LI77685 Incorrect output with c_loc() c_ptr allocatable pointer
LI77525 XLF incorrect result from libmass
LI77664 Incorrect OMP REDUCTION clause error
LI77665 Internal compiler error with C_F_POINTER
LI77669 Incorrect implied-do array construction
LI77689 Internal compiler error in xlfentry with cyclical type declaration
LI77607 Installation errors on SLES11 SP3
LI77608 October 2013 Update for XL Fortran for Linux, V14.1
LI77609 October 2013 Runtime for XL Fortran for Linux, V14.1

Fix Pack 3 (14.1.0.3)
Link Date Released Status
APAR Description
LI77372 Large record in program may cause wrong output
LI77328 f77 'LOCK' variable name keyword conflict
LI77374 Segfaults with non-XLF compiled modules
LI77375 Internal compiler error in xlfentry
LI77376 Internal compiler error in XLFHOT
LI77377 Internal compiler error with invalid component
LI77378 Internal compiler error at -O3
LI77379 Internal compiler error at -O3 and -qstrict
LI77380 Incorrect output from select case statement with MPI
LI77332 Stabs error for array bounded by static value
LI77382 Warning message when max cpu_id to startproc
LI77370 April 2013 Update for XL Fortran for Linux, V14.1
LI77371 April 2013 Runtime for XL Fortran for Linux, V14.1

Fix Pack 2 (14.1.0.2)
Link Date Released Status
APAR Description
LI77164 Test failures with large OpenMP thread counts
LI77165 XLF error in SingleConversion
LI77166 -qintsize=2 or 8 causes incorrect compiler error1
LI77127 Internal compiler error at -O2 in xlfentry
LI77128 Compiler no longer diagnoses array constructors values
LI77169 Compiler error in xlfhot with -qintsize=8
LI77133 Link errors due to multiple definitions
LI77134 Internal compiler error in ASTI
LI77135 Compilation hangs at -O3 in IPA
LI77173 Internal signal error from ipa
LI77176 December 2012 Update for XL Fortran for Linux, V14.1
LI77177 December 2012 Runtime for XL Fortran for Linux, V14.1

Fix Pack 1 (14.1.0.1)
Link Date Released Status
APAR Description
LI76992 omp_set_schedule call is ignored
LI77009 Internal compiler error in xlCcode
LI76994 Interface incorrectly flagged as ambiguous
LI77011 Internal compiler error from pointer
LI76996 Internal compiler error with bgxlf2003
LI76971 September 2012 Update for XL Fortran for Linux, V14.1
LI76972 September 2012 Runtime for XL Fortran for Linux, V14.1

Initial Release (14.1)
Link Date Released Status
Download options:

Table of Contents:


Fix Pack 8 (13.1.0.8)
Link Date Released Status
APAR Description
LI77457 XLF error in singleconversion
LI77412 Internal compiler error at -O2 in xlfentry
LI77423 Wrong formatting output
LI77424 Incorrect implied-do array construction
LI77461 Internal compiler error with invalid component
LI77462 Incorrect results with DIMENSION attribute
LI77426 Incorrect output with function pointer
LI77464 Internal signal error from ipa
LI77467 June 2013 Update for XL Fortran for Linux, V13.1
LI77468 June 2013 Runtime for XL Fortran for Linux, V13.1

Fix Pack 7 (13.1.0.7)
Link Date Released Status
APAR Description
LI77043 Internal compiler error in xlCcode
LI77044 Stabstring undefined type error
LI77045 Internal error from syntax error
LI76785 Interface incorrectly marked as ambiguous
LI77014 Segfault in RTE with OPEN(...,status='REPLACE')
LI77041 October 2012 Update for XL Fortran for Linux, V13.1
LI77042 October 2012 Runtime for XL Fortran for Linux, V13.1

Fix Pack 6 (13.1.0.6)
Link Date Released Status
APAR Description
LI76621 Internal compiler error in xlf with -O2
LI76786 Incorrect trap with optimization
LI76798 Memory fault with -qsmp=omp
LI76787 Signal 11 in ipa64 at -O3
LI76800 Internal compiler error with -O3 and -qreport
LI76801 IPA linking with wrong library
LI76837 June 2012 Update for XL Fortran for Linux, V13.1
LI76838 June 2012 Runtime for XL Fortran for Linux, V13.1

Fix Pack 6 (13.1.0.5)
Link Date Released Status
APAR Description
LI76415 Internal compiler assert in load_base
LI76634 Performance degradation with -qhot
LI76613 Compilation hang with -O3 -qhot
LI76619 -qsimd=auto causing error for qarch=pwr7
LI76637 Intrinsic assignment problem
LI76640 February 2012 Update for XL Fortran for Linux, V13.1
LI76641 February 2012 Runtime for XL Fortran for Linux, V13.1

Fix Pack 4 (13.1.0.4)
Link Date Released Status
APAR Description
LI76466 Incorrect output with xlfhot
LI76467 Incorrect trap with maxval and minval
LI76468 Static scheduling can cause hang at runtime
LI76437 Missing stabstring type for ENTRY parameter
LI76439 -qlistfmt=xml leads to compilation hang
LI76441 Internal compiler error with -qfloat=nofold
LI76358 PWR7 MASS improvements for misaligned data
LI76464 October 2011 Update for XL Fortran for Linux, V13.1
LI76465 October 2011 Runtime for XL Fortran for Linux, V13.1

Fix Pack 3 (13.1.0.3)
Link Date Released Status
APAR Description
LI76278 Block data leads to internal compiler error
LI76072 Segmentation fault in stub code
LI76298 Performance of 32b loop counters in 64b mode
LI76044 Incorrect calculation results with -qhot
LI76299 Incorrect branch optimization
LI76280 Bad stabstring with Fortran parameter
LI76283 Stabstring entry missing type with -qrecur
LI76284 Missing stabstring type for Fortran ENTRY
LI76143 Internal compiler error in xlfcode
LI76303 Performance degradation.
LI75927 Signal 6 in xlfcode
LI76285 Support for data type leads to syntax error
LI76304 Internal compiler error with -qattr and -qxref
LI76295 July 2011 Update for XL Fortran for Linux, V13.1
LI76296 July 2011 Runtime for XL Fortran for Linux, V13.1

Fix Pack 2 (13.1.0.2)
Link Date Released Status
APAR Description
LI76090 Memory leak issue for auto arrays
LI76053 Internal compiler error with optimization -O
LI75814 Superfluous extsw with POPCNT intrinsic
LI76054 Loop/crash with -qarch pwr4 and above
LI76056 Position independent mass routines
LI76065 Non standard prog compiles w/o (L) msg
LI76095 Typo causing internal compiler error
LI76096 Wrongfully emitted warning message
LI76066 Internal compiler error
LI76073 Incorrect assign with allocation with xlf2003
LI76076 Internal compiler error with incorrect print
LI76080 Parse stack overflow
LI76083 SAVE attribute is not set
LI76089 Incorrect Trace/BPT Trap causing app to core
IZ92366 Invalid procedure argument error
LI76103 Runtime fails to read items in namelist
LI76092 Incorrect invocation of user procedures
LI76093 Incorrect logical expression evaluation
LI75756 Internal compiler error with -q64 and -O3
LI75761 Problems with vscosisin and vcosisin libraries
LI75827 Improving mass vector library performance
LI76086 April 2011 Update for XL Fortran for Linux, V13.1
LI76087 April 2011 Runtime for XL Fortran for Linux, V13.1

Table of Contents:


Fix Pack 8 (12.1.0.8)
Link Date Released Status
RHEL5/RHEL6 APARs Description
LI77798 Incorrect output with function pointer
LI77826 XLF error in signleconversion
LI77827 Internal compiler error with invalid component
LI77808 January 2014 Update for XL Fortran for Linux, V12.1 (RHEL 5)
LI77809 January 2014 Runtime for XL Fortran for Linux, V12.1 (RHEL 5/RHEL 6)
SLES10/SLES11 APARs Description
LI77800 Incorrect output with function pointer
LI77829 XLF error in signleconversion
LI77830 Internal compiler error with invalid component
LI77810 January 2014 Update for XL Fortran for Linux, V12.1 (SLES 10/ SLES 11)
LI77811 January 2014 Runtime for XL Fortran for Linux, V12.1 (SLES 10/ SLES 11)

Fix Pack 7 (12.1.0.7)
Link Date Released Status
APAR Description
LI76580 Incorrect result with -qsmp=omp
LI76581 Assembler can not open file
LI76584 -qhot causing threads to loop full
LI76598 January 2012 Update for XL Fortran for Linux, V12.1 (RHEL 5)
LI76599 January 2012 Runtime for XL Fortran for Linux, V12.1 (RHEL 5/RHEL 6)
LI76586 Incorrect result with -qsmp=omp
LI76587 Assembler can not open file
LI76480 -qhot causing threads to loop full
LI76600 January 2012 Update for XL Fortran for Linux, V12.1 (SLES 10/ SLES 11)
LI76601 January 2012 Runtime for XL Fortran for Linux, V12.1 (SLES 10/ SLES 11)

Fix Pack 6 (12.1.0.6)
Link Date Released Status
APAR Description
LI76239 Incorrect logical expression evaluation
LI76252 Segfault with procedure containing optional arg
LI76267 Adding RHEL6 support to XL Fortran for Linux, V12.1 RTE (RHEL 5)
LI76190 June 2011 Update for XL Fortran for Linux, V12.1 (RHEL 5)
LI76191 June 2011 Runtime for XL Fortran for Linux, V12.1 (RHEL 5)
LI76240 Incorrect logical expression evaluation
LI76254 Segfault with procedure containing optional arg
LI76192 June 2011 Update for XL Fortran for Linux, V12.1 (SLES 10/SLES 11)
LI76193 June 2011 Runtime for XL Fortran for Linux, V12.1 (SLES 10/SLES 11)

Fix Pack 5 (12.1.0.5)
Link Date Released Status
APAR Description
LI75883 Elimination of unnecessary F90 array copies
LI75921 -C causing unexpected Trace/BPT trap
LI75922 -qcheck (-C) results in compiler failure
LI75923 Memory leak issue for auto arrays
LI75884 Application runtime segfault
LI75925 Compiler limit exceeded in xlfhot
LI75926 Segfault due to segment violation
LI75886 Incorrect result/segmentation fault from App
LI75928 Accuracy of compiler msg for modified mod file
LI75929 Application segfault with xlf
LI75930 Fatal error in xlfentry with debug option on
LI75916 January 2011 Update for XL Fortran for Linux, V12.1 (RHEL 5)
LI75917 January 2011 Runtime for XL Fortran for Linux, V12.1 (RHEL 5)
LI75889 Elimination of unnecessary F90 array copies
LI75932 -C causing unexpected Trace/BPT trap
LI75933 -qcheck (-C) results in compiler failure
LI75934 Memory leak issue for auto arrays
LI75900 Application runtime segfault
LI75936 Compiler limit exceeded in xlfhot
LI75937 Segfault due to segment violation
LI75901 Incorrect result/segmentation fault from App
LI75939 Accuracy of compiler msg for modified mod file
LI75940 Application segfault with xlf
LI75941 Fatal error in xlfentry with debug option on
LI75918 January 2011 Update for XL Fortran for Linux, V12.1 (SLES 10/SLES 11)
LI75919 January 2011 Runtime for XL Fortran for Linux, V12.1 (SLES 10/SLES 11)

Related information

V.R.M.F. Maintenance Stream Delivery Vehicle glossary
Software Product Compatibility Reports
Fix Central
Latest updates for supported IBM XL Fortran compilers
XL Fortran for AIX library
XL Fortran for Linux library
XL Fortran for Blue Gene/Q library
Unsupported IBM XL Fortran compiler updates

Rate this page:

(0 users)Average rating

Document information


More support for:

XL Fortran for Linux
Compiler

Software version:

12.1, 13.1, 14.1, 15.1, 15.1.1

Operating system(s):

Linux

Reference #:

7038812

Modified date:

2014-12-12

Translate my page

Machine Translation

Content navigation